[CFD-Post] Plot of pressure on an airfoil
 
Hi,

I have a simple problem with CFD-Post. I can't manage to make a simple plot of the pressure (or somethng else) on a surface. The idea is to get something like this : http://www.grc.nasa.gov/WWW/wind/val...rflap01/cp.jpg

I made some charts with a line but it is not possible to use a plane as a data series for the chart. What's the trick for this ?

Thanks
Charles

flotus1 January 29, 2013 11:31

My first guess is that you need a polyline through the intersection of a plane and a boundary.
This polyline can then be used as the input geometry for a 2D plot.
